Try using masking tape along seam to SID. This is how my daughter learned to SID.
Masking tape or painters tape can also be used to quilt beside so that you don't need to mark your lines for quilting 1/4" from the seam or any echo quilting, especially when doing hand quilting. I use 2" wide tape at a slant when I am quilting a wide border. No marking! For one quilt, I marked a chain pattern on copy paper, pinned it to the wide border, and sewed a straight stitch just as fast as I could sew. It worked beautifully. I plan to try it again.
